billybobsky,

What you are seeing is the magic of AJAX. As you type, a JavaScript periodically calls up a special page on the server and gets a list of matches that are displayed in the list. vBulletin 3.5 added this functionality to fields for member names.

AJAX uses a complicated set of functions to pull this off. It's certainly possible to add this popup to the search field on the Membes List page, but I'm not comfortable enough writing the code for it right now. Maybe in the future when I have more time to delve into vB's particular implementation I'll consider it.
